Lady Luck

Kristen Ashley. Grand Central/Forever, $7 mass market (672p) ISBN 978-1-455-59910-3

Ashley’s gritty third Colorado Mountain contemporary western (after Sweet Dreams) is lengthy but surprisingly fast-paced. Ex-con Ty Walker has vowed vengeance on the people who framed him. Gorgeous clotheshorse Lexie Berry is forced to do a favor for Shift, her deceased boyfriend’s scummy best friend, and picks up Ty after he is released from prison. What Shift didn’t tell Lexie is that he promised to set Ty up with a temporary wife so that he can return to Colorado and embark on his plan for revenge. After Ty explains and offers Lexie $50,000, she agrees to marry him, planning to use the money to start over once Ty’s “business” is concluded and they divorce. They head to Ty’s home in Carnal, Colo., where he resumes his former life and tries to keep his distance from her. Sizzling sex and a healthy dose of mystery will keep readers enthralled, though the heaps of profanity may not sit well with fans of sweeter romances. (July)
